Lay Zhang holds fan meet in Manila

- MARK BONIFACIO

LAY Zhang, also known as Zhang Yixing, is a Chinese singer-songwriter, dancer, music producer, actor, and author famous for his M-pop, hip-hop, EDM, and R&B music. He debuted with the K-Pop group Exo in 2012, and since 2015, he has received multiple awards as a soloist. Moreover, he’s known for his original tracks “Let’s Shut Up and Dance,” “Sheep,” “Honey,” “Dawn to Dusk,” and “Joker.” Furthermor­e, he recently received the Weibo Music Awards for Weibo God and Producer of the Year.

As soon as Warner Music Philippine­s announced that Manila was the first stop for Lay’s fan meeting and listening party, fans, also known as XBACKS, were ecstatic as it has been ten years since the artist last visited the country.

Lay opened the show in Teatrino Promenade with “Right Back,” with lyrics expressing how much they miss their partner, who’s far away, while simultaneo­usly promising to meet again. “Boom” is a danceable track with a catchy chorus, focusing on the character’s fascinatio­n with someone remarkable.

He greeted the audience cheerfully and even remarked, “Maganda kayo!” instantly made everyone’s hearts melt. Consequent­ly, the attendees didn’t wait any longer and chanted, “Grandline!” the musician’s official tour in hopes of bringing the show to Manila.

After the performanc­es and introducti­on, the program proceeded with a Q&A segment.

Lay revealed that he wanted to visit his Filipino fans more often, and the audience once again took the chance and requested to conduct his Grandline tour in Manila, which Lay agreed to organize soon.

He also expressed that his fans keep him motivated and love his job.

The multi-talented performer also shared his dreams for the future, and asked the fans to suggest musicians he could collaborat­e with, adding, “I will listen to you guys; give me the direction.”

Right after, the fans prepared a heartwarmi­ng video to show their appreciati­on for the multi-talented and lovable artist. The project featured throwback clips of Lay, fans dedicating a song, a heartfelt letter, and a recap of their cup-sleeve event for the artist’s birthday. Specifical­ly, supporters expressed their appreciati­on for the artist and for fulfilling his promise to visit the country.

Moreover, fans revealed how inspiring

Lay has been in their lives and assured the artist that he has their unconditio­nal support. On top of that, the attendees serenaded the artist with his original track in acapella, making the artist sing along as well during the heartwarmi­ng surprise.

After being engulfed in the beautiful gift the supporters presented, Lay was grateful for their thoughtful­ness, sharing, “When I’m in China, I cannot see you guys, but you do a lot for me. Now, I fulfill the promise. That’s why I’m here today. I brought in new tracks. Nobody has heard this. You are the first ones to listen.”

Ultimately, the musician launched a special listening party for his unreleased songs, leaving fans on the edge of their seats. The first snippet revealed is a rhythmic electropop track entitled “Psychic,” and the second song is a groovy disco-pop number, “Step.” Both have promising and electrifyi­ng sounds that he will release in the first half of 2024.
